K-Lock nuts, also known as Keps nuts and external tooth hex nuts, have an attached free-spinning washer that has external teeth, preventing the nut from rotating. They are often used in applications where there is a risk of loosening due to vibrations.

Usage

K-lock nuts are spun onto bolts and screws to secure components, the teeth of the attached washer biting into the material to prevent rotation.
 

Industries

K-lock nuts are used in a variety of industries, including electronics, appliances, and construction.
